Частота отсечки и альфа для каскадного цифрового фильтра нижних частот - PullRequest
0 голосов
/ 27 июня 2019

Я хочу каскадировать простой цифровой LPF.Без каскадирования я вычисляю альфа по этой формуле:

α = (2πfΔt) / (2πfΔt + 1)

, а частота отсечена следующим образом:

fc = α / (2π (1-α) Δt)

А теперь, как получить альфа и fc, если я хочу каскадировать этот фильтр, например, 5 раз или любой другой?

Вот моя реализация LPF:

lpf_alpha(pv,cv,alpha){
    ;return CV*alpha + PV*(1-alpha)
    return alpha*(CV-PV) + PV
}
...